Cement pavement replacement services involve removing and replacing damaged or deteriorated sections of existing concrete surfaces, such as driveways, sidewalks, or parking areas. This process typically begins with carefully breaking up the old, worn-out concrete, then preparing the foundation to ensure a stable base for the new pavement. The new concrete is then poured, leveled, and finished to create a smooth, durable surface that can withstand daily use. This service is essential for restoring the appearance and functionality of outdoor surfaces that have become cracked, uneven, or compromised over time.
Many common problems can be addressed through cement pavement replacement. Cracks, spalling, and uneven surfaces are signs that the existing concrete has reached the end of its lifespan or has been damaged by weather, ground movement, or heavy use. Left unaddressed, these issues can lead to further deterioration, increased tripping hazards, and potential property damage. Replacement helps eliminate these safety concerns while improving the overall look of a property’s exterior, making it safer and more appealing for residents, visitors, or customers.

The overview below groups typical Cement Pavement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Avon, IN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or cement pavement repairs in Avon, IN range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ching and crack repairs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and surface area.
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of cement pavement us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more complex partial replacements can reach $4,000 or more, with fewer projects pushing into this higher tier.
Full Pavement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of a cement pavement surface generally costs from $4,000 to $8,000. Larger driveways or extensive projects tend to fall into the upper part of this range, though most are within the middle.
Industrial or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ive or commercial cement pavement replacements can exceed $10,000, especially for large areas or complex installations. Such projects are less common and typically reach into the higher end of the cost spectrum.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
